All 13 municipalities in the province of Camagüey have the fourth generation network (4G/LTE) of mobile telephony, with the installation this year of two radio bases in Jimaguayú and Najasa, the only municipalities that did not have the technology.

The Pharmaceutical Museum of Matanzas, formerly Botica Francesa, dedicated the reopening of its events and concerts hall on Monday to Dr. María Dolores de Figueroa, Cuba's first woman pharmacist, in honor of International Women's Day in this city.
